What are the most common Lexus repair issues for drivers in the Fisher, PA area?

Given our rural roads and winter weather, common issues include suspension wear from potholes, brake system maintenance due to hilly terrain, and battery/electrical problems exacerbated by cold starts. Lexus models like the RX and ES also frequently need attention for dashboard display failures and water pump leaks.

When should I seek local service instead of driving to a distant dealership?

For most routine maintenance and common repairs, a qualified local Fisher-area shop can provide faster, often more affordable service without the long drive to Pittsburgh or State College. However, for highly complex hybrid system issues or warranty-covered recalls, the dealership's specialized tools and direct manufacturer support may be necessary.

Are repair costs for a Lexus higher in rural Pennsylvania compared to cities?

Labor rates in the Fisher area are typically more competitive than in major metropolitan dealerships, which can lower overall costs. However, the price for specialized Lexus parts remains consistent, and some shops may add a modest logistical fee for ordering these parts to our rural location.
